To solve the circuit variables problem, start by expressing power as the product of current and voltage, P = I * V, using the given functions for v(t) and i(t). Take the derivative of power with respect to time and set it to zero to find critical points, which indicate maximum power. Remember to consider initial conditions, particularly that power is zero for t < 0 due to no current. After finding the time that maximizes power, substitute it back into the power equation to determine the maximum power.
